Transaction 23d993abe3cfb83ad4aa3eee56e2993fb6554ac98ecd80bb37bac55afdcaab58
1 Input
2 Outputs
- 23d993abe3cfb83ad4aa3eee56e2993fb6554ac98ecd80bb37bac55afdcaab58:0
- 23d993abe3cfb83ad4aa3eee56e2993fb6554ac98ecd80bb37bac55afdcaab58:1
value 35281859
address 1EkxPkaBEEgUMrBPTNjd6nAW6Bom5ggQ2F
value 20658356
address 1BHAhYxXxLFodq8n8usTPn2JjSke4DUXST